What happened
While working on getting Line B setup turning around & tripped on metal floor covers near green honeycomb control panel fell forward hitting his head above right eyebrow causing a small gash & tried to stop his fall with his left arm which caused pain.
Injury or illness
Laceration of Soft Tissue-Head Upper Arm Right Side - head injury laceration above right eye required stitches and left arm pain.
